As the festive season draws closer and occupancy levels rise, we know housekeeping teams are put under further pressure to service bedrooms and meet the rising demand for clean linen. To help alleviate this pressure and ensure a fuss-free festive period, we’ve put together our top tips to ensure you have the right amount of linen when and where you need it.

  1. Check your delivery schedule in advance. With CLEAN as your linen provider, changes can easily be made to future deliveries so if you know your occupancy levels are going to be higher than expected, let us know and we’ll happily supply you with what you need.
  2. Don’t forget to submit your linen counts. This ensures we are able to provide you with the right amount of linen when and where you need it.
  3. Fill cages with as much dirty linen as possible. Filling up cages fully ensures there are plenty of empty cages in circulation for all of our customers keeping things running as efficiently as possible.
  4. Only order the stock that you need. Over ordering can deplete the overall stock available in the linen pool which can have an effect on other customers. It’s important that at one of the busiest times of year not to stock pile but communicate any peaks to your account manager as quickly as possible – with a network of laundries across the UK we can utilise stock from our other laundries to meet additional needs at very short notice.
  5. Return any imperfect items regularly. Occasionally you’ll find an item that has slipped through our quality control net, make sure you return these as soon as possible so we can replace them as necessary and return them to you shiny and new, ensuring your levels of clean linen is not affected.
  6. Have your soiled stock ready for collection. This keeps our drivers and deliveries on time for all of our customers. We’re a flexible team of professionals so if you need to change your times or want to change the pick-up location then we can accommodate this providing your dedicated contact is aware.
  7. Who manages your linen levels? By making sure more than one team member is trained in managing your linen levels, means cover can be provided when staff members are away.
